The lasershades are not OD 5+, they are, from what I hear, closer to the 2-3OD range. The WL sports elites were OD 5+ and it was overkill, you couldnt' see the dot at all, period, and that made the laser even more dangerous to use. For a 200mW laser though, OD 2-3 should be more than adequate protection.

However, I would probably steer clear of those $38 goggles posted above. SenKat has posted a few times about the seller's horrible business practices. The worst thing would be to get goggles you think are protecting you, when they really aren't.
